Core A: Administrative Core
SUMMARY/ABSTRACT
The Administrative Core (Admin Core) will be responsible for the oversight and daily functions of the SPORE and
provide organizational leadership for the overall successful conduct of the program. It will provide organizational
leadership and administrative support for all of the aspects of the SPORE, including coordination and
communication between all investigators and committee members. It will provide scientific management, including
ongoing management and scientific review of all projects and cores to ensure that the stated scientific goals of the
SPORE are met. The Core has ultimate responsibility for the overall financial management of the budget and
appropriate filing of budgetary information. It will organize regularly scheduled meetings and seminars, and
provide commitment of SPORE investigators to attend the annual NCI Translational Science Meeting and other
relevant workshops. The scheduling and organization of an annual UCLA Brain Cancer SPORE Symposium,
including participation of the External Advisory Board, will be the responsibility of the Administrative Core. This
core will oversee the administration of the SPORE Developmental Research and Career Enhancement Programs,
while providing oversight of all the established policies for recruitment of women and minorities. It will be the
liaison between the SPORE and the NCI-designated Jonsson Comprehensive Cancer Center, other UCLA
academic and administrative bodies, NIH/NCI staff, IAB/EAB members, and patient advocacy groups. It will
ensure that appropriate regulatory approvals are maintained and will complete necessary documentation with
regulatory agencies. The Administrative Core will also ensure that data and resources are shared appropriately in
order to promote intra- and inter-SPORE collaboration, including maintenance and updating of a UCLA Brain
SPORE website. The brain tumor community at UCLA has been in existence for almost 20 years and has a track
record of productivity. As such, the leadership of the Administrative Core of this SPORE is well-integrated in many
ways to the higher administration levels of the institution.
